Reports To: Superintendent
Primary Job Responsibility: To provide leadership in developing, maintaining and implementing the best possible certified and classified staff for Muhlenberg County Schools. To assist the Superintendent in the execution of duties and responsibilities at the school, district and state level.
Essential Functions of Job Responsibility:
Administration and Personnel
Plans and directs a program for the recruitment, selections and assignment of the best qualified staff in all job classifications to include job announcements, application procedures and interviews.
Administers and monitors the Board's policy on all matters of recruitment, hiring, training, transfers, promotion, compensation and other benefits in compliance with EEOC regulations.
Oversees the Maintenance of all Certified and Classified Employee Files/Records.
District Random Drug Testing Program Coordinator.
Title IX Coordinator.
Implements all rules and regulations, Policies and Procedures as adopted by the Board of Education.
Responsible for Policy and Employees handbook. District Certified Evaluation Contact.
Serves as consultant for the Transportation Department.
Communicates to the Superintendent matters relating to employees.
Conducts investigations in district matters as required by the Education Professional Standards Board, Office of Education Accountability, and the Division of Management Assistance.
Investigates Parent and Employee Grievances.
Compiles, assembles, and submits the Minority Educator Recruitment and Retention Annual Report.
Monitors and Calculates personnel staffing allocations both certified and classified for district schools.
Coordinates staffing with principals and central office administrators. Screens and processes applications for certified/classified personnel. Monitors evaluation process of all certified/classified personnel.
Assists in interpreting Board Policies and State laws.
Education and Experience:
School Superintendent Certification
TERMS OF EMPLOYMENT:
240 days. Salary and work year to be established by the Board.
EVALUATION: Performance of this job will be evaluated in accordance with provisions of the Board's policy on Evaluation of Certified Personnel.
